Spicy Kale

Cook Time:

15 Minutes

Ingredients

Veggies:

  • Tri-color peppers  (1/2 c) 

  • Red Onions (1/4 c) 

  • Fresh kale (1-2 c)



Toppings: 

  • Red pepper flakes 

  • Mrs. Dash Chipotle seasoning



Spices: (season to taste)

  • Onion Powder (1 tsp) 

  • Garlic Powder (1 tsp) 

  • Sea Salt (just a dash) 

  • Black Pepper (just a dash) 

  • Red pepper flakes (1/2 tsp) 



Don't Forget:

  • Grapeseed Oil ( 1-2 tbsp -  or any other oil you have)

Preparation

Step 1


add low heat to your pan and 1-2 tbsp of grapeseed oil 



Step 2


add diced tri-color peppers and red onions with a dash of sea salt, black pepper, onion powder and garlic power to your pan



Step 3


sautee your veggies for 3-5 minutes  and de-stalk your kale and rise well while you wait



Step 4


add kale to the pan with another tbsp of grapeseed oil and seasoning (including the red pepper flakes this time)



Step 5


let your kale to cook down and soften (you will notice that the large cups of kale you once had will shrivel) for 4-7 minutes or so



Step 6


once your kale is to your liking (I like mine a little crispy so I turn my heat up to medium for the last couple minutes) give it a taste and add more spices as needed



Step 7


Serve on your favorite plate or as a side with your main dish
